Leadership Review Briefing — Regional Sales. Northvale region missed plan by 6%; Eastmoor exceeded by 3%. Shortfall traced to delayed Quillbrook launches, not demand. Pipeline coverage stands at 2.1x for next quarter. Finance should hold current forecasts and flag any discounting above 8%. A restricted note on forward plans appears below.

management briefing: Headcount on the Quenael team goes from 9 to 80 by the end of July. Gross margin on Quenael came in at 15 percent against a plan of 20 percent.

### Account Recovery — Catalogue Import (Lintwood)

Quick one for review: when the Lintwood catalogue import wipes a patron's session table, the recovery flow re-seeds accounts from the nightly snapshot. Check that the importer skips locked accounts — last time it didn't. To rerun recovery against staging you'll need the vault passphrase, which is appended just below.

recovery phrase for yafof-tajof: julmir-kelax-julvan-holath-belvan-holir-ralael-ralvan-ralath-julvan-silmir-istmir-kaswyn-ulamir

Onboarding — Hartgale webhook delivery. Retries follow exponential backoff: five attempts over roughly fifteen minutes, then the event parks in the dead-letter queue for manual replay. Delivery is at-least-once, so consumers must be idempotent; dedupe on the event sequence number, never the timestamp. New team members should replay a parked event in staging first. The staging replay tool will prompt for the recovery passphrase listed below.

unlock words, bahop-fawef: novmir-druwyn-soriel-rusdor-kasion

Welcome to on-call for Tarnquil. One heads-up: the translation-string extraction script runs nightly and blocks the release train if it finds unquoted placeholders. Don't rerun it manually more than once; it locks the strings repo. If it fails twice, page localization, not eng. The troubleshooting steps are written up here.

operations page: https://confluence.qorvellabs.internal/pages/projects/projects/projects